Non-rigid registration method for longitudinal chest CT images in Covid-19 Yuma Iwao (QST), Naoko Kawata, Yuki Segiguchi, Hideaki Haneishi (Chiba Univ) MI2022-41 |

(in English) |
In time series analysis of the lungs, a non-rigid registration method that compensates for differences in respiratory status is needed. Recently, several accurate and fast methods using deep learning have been proposed, but their applicability to time series CT of COVID-19 patients with lesion site changes has not been tested. In this study, we propose a practical process to apply a deep learning method called Voxel Morph to time-series chest CT, and verify its robustness to the imaging features of lesions in COVID-19 patients. |
